What is Acoustic Engineering?
Outcome‑focused design: reverse engineering from people‑centric results our clients want. We use advanced computational tools to inform designs, such as the HOME Theatre complex where we mathematically predicted the response to mounting the building on springs to mitigate groundborne rail vibration, and a web giant’s European HQ in London where we modeled noise distraction in an open‑plan office.
Communication
We focus on conveying results to clients across key technical areas such as noise break‑in, internal sound transmission, reverberation control, building services noise, structural dynamics, audio‑visual design, public address, voice alarm, and vibration. Engagement is a key focus, exemplified by our work with Equinox retrofitting gyms inside listed buildings and the new Faculty of Arts building at Warwick University, where we translated faculty requirements into engineering solutions.
Challenge
We are motivated by complex challenges, from ultra‑high‑tech projects like Dyson’s campus and Imperial College Michael Uren buildings to unique architectural forms such as the Museum of the Future.
Projects
* BBC Concert Studios, London (2017–ongoing) – Overseeing acoustic engineering for the BBC Symphony Orchestra’s new home and the Maida Vale recording studios.
* Spotify European HQ, Berlin (2019–ongoing) – Managing acoustics for the main atrium performance space and controlling building services noise.
* The Factory, Manchester (2017–2023) – Designing acoustics for a cultural venue with multiple performance spaces integrated over historic rail arches.
